Some people believe that teaching children at home is best for a child's development while others think that it is important for children to go to school.
Discuss the advantages of both methods and give your own opinion.

This essay discusses about the two important ways child can be brought up and its varied implications. It is commonly agreed that a child's major intellectual development happens during the age of 4 to 15 and is based on the quality of education he/she received during this period. During this age group, children can be compared to potter's clay that can be moulded to any desired shape and education incarnate the role of potter here. Educating a child at home and at school have its own merits.

As discussed, we can first examine the practice of teaching students at home. It’s a traditional and archaic way of education but is still having lot of positive aspects. Education at home can make a child feel liberated and will enable him to sensitise the nature, society and culture in a magnificent way. Such a nurturing can equip a child to lead a more peaceful life without getting distracted by the worldly pleasures like money and luxury.

On the other hand, sending a child to school have its own merits as well. A formal school education can acclimatise a child to the modern world faster and can make him/her ready for facing current day challenges in an efficient manner. It can quickly form and sharpen different competencies of a child like team playing skills, communication skills and problem solving skills.

In general both ways of teaching ie, at home or at school have lots of advantages while the outcome received from them are extremely different. In my opinion parents should be very conscious about the expected results achieved in both tracks. The parents should conduct wide discussions with experts and should reach a consensus before selecting a track. But whatever may be the track it is sure that both can do much good to a child.
